本文对误差分离技术,在圆柱度测量中的应用进行了初步探讨。实践证明,应用误差分离技术,能将圆柱度线量中工件的形状误差与量仪的轴系误差、立柱导轨的直线性等系统误差分离开来。该技术的推广应用,可以保证在不提高量仪精度的前提下,大大提高测量精度,也可以用精度较低的标准件,去检测高精度的轴系阳圆度仪等,从而降低了量仪和标准件的精度要求与成本,具有很大的经济价值。
